NTPC and BPDP sign Joint Venture Agreement to set up coal based power project in Bangladesh

  • (1888PressRelease) February 03, 2012 - NTPC Limited and Bangladesh Power Development Board (BPDP), the premiere power utility of Bangladesh, wholly owned by Govt. of Bangladesh, signed a Joint Venture Agreement in Dhaka on 29th January, 2012 for setting up coal based Power project(s) in Bangladesh with equal (50:50) equity participation on Build, Own and Operate basis.. The Project shall be a landmark in bilateral economic cooperation between India and Bangladesh.

    The Joint Venture Agreement was signed by Shri Arup Roy Choudhury, CMD, NTPC and ASM Alamgir Kabir, Chairman BPDP. Dignitaries present from Bangladesh side included Mr. A. Muhit, Minister of Finance, Dr. Mashiur Rahman, Advisor (Economic) to PM, Dr. Taufiq Ellahi Chaudhury, Adv. (Power) to PM, Md. Enamul Haq, Minister of State for Power, Mr. Tariq Karim, High Commissioner of Bangladesh to India, Md. Abul Kalam Azad, Secretary (Power Division). From Indian side Shri. P. Uma Shankar, Secretary (Power), Mr. Sanjay Bhattacharya, Acting Indian High Commissioner to Bangladesh, Shri. Inderjit Kapoor, Director (Comml.), Mr. A K Gupta, GM (BD) and Mr. U K Bhattacharya, DGM (BD) of NTPC were present.

    A site at Bagerhat district (Khulna Division) of Bangladesh has been identified for developing a 1320MW (2X660MW) imported coal based power project with super critical technology. Detailed Feasibility Report for the Project has been prepared. Entire power generated by the Power project shall be supplied to BPDB, to meet growing requirements of Bangladesh.
